The Steamed White Fish
Steaming white fish preserves imperative nutrients while eliminating potential allergens found in seasonings or oils. You can use cod, haddock, or flounder, ensuring the fish is bone-free and sourced from a clean, reliable supplier. Never feed raw fish regularly, as it may contain thiaminase, an enzyme that breaks down thiamine and can lead to neurological issues over time. This simple preparation results in a soft, easily digestible treat ideal for cats with gastrointestinal sensitivities.
The Baked Rabbit Slice
You prepare this treat using lean, boneless rabbit meat, which is one of the least allergenic proteins for cats with sensitive digestion. After slicing the meat thinly, bake it at a low temperature until dehydrated but still tender, preserving nutrients while eliminating harmful bacteria. This method avoids fillers, grains, and artificial preservatives, making it ideal for cats prone to gastrointestinal flare-ups or skin reactions. A single slice, offered two to three times weekly, supports muscle maintenance without overloading the digestive system.

Q: Can I use frozen fish for the steamed white fish treat recipe?
A: Yes, frozen white fish such as cod or haddock can be used as long as it is thoroughly thawed and rinsed before steaming. Freezing can help reduce the risk of parasites, but the fish must be plain, without added salt, seasonings, or marinades. Once steamed and flaked, it can be portioned into tiny cubes and stored in an ice cube tray with low-sodium broth for easy serving. Q: How long can homemade hypoallergenic treats be stored safely?
A: Most homemade cat treats last up to five days in the refrigerator when kept in an airtight container. For longer storage, freezing is recommended-treats like baked rabbit slices or fish cubes can be frozen for up to three months without significant nutrient loss. Thaw individual portions in the fridge overnight before serving.
